Before I went to Xi 'an, I went to the local youth hostel and found a youth hostel near the Big Wild Goose Pagoda. It was my first time to stay in a youth hostel.
Get off the bus according to the checked route or take a bus all the way to the vicinity of the Big Wild Goose Pagoda, and find a youth hostel to live for a long time. This youth tour should be regarded as a typical one, but it is novel, because it is my first time to stay.
The first floor of the Youth Travel Service is that kind of activity room. There is a big kang in it and a table in the middle, which is used to play chess. Then there is a hall next to it. There are many tables and stools. On one side, there is a blackboard on the whole wall, on which are written the boss's travel advice to tourists and many tourists' messages. On the other side, there is a big bookshelf filled with all kinds of books. On the other side of the hall, there is a pool table for everyone to play with. All the rooms are above the second floor, and the first floor is all for everyone to play.

At noon the next day, my friends and I went to Huimin Street in Xi 'an. I feel that many meals in Huimin Street are really authentic Xi pasta, just like the mutton bread in soup that I ate for the first time. Maybe I, a southerner who eats rice, can't get used to this kind of food, and I don't think it's as delicious as the legend, but the local meat buns are absolutely first-class praise. There are many people in Huimin Street. It is suggested that you don't have to go to the particularly delicious shops uploaded on the Internet, just find some local shops.
